Where to throw away the packaging after hair varnish? A mistake can cost you a lot
In terms of segregation, the so -called problem waste. Many people have no idea which container they should reach. At first glance, they do not fully match any container, which is why we are guided by intuition and they do not know. An example of such rubbish are aerosol cans, e.g. whipped spray cream, varnish for hair, air freshener, deodorant and insect spray.
Inside, in addition to the product itself, there may also be glow gas. If we throw the aerosol into a bad container, it can explode in adverse conditions. In addition, the product contained in the can can leak and mix with other chemicals. That is why choosing the correct container is so important.
Where to throw away the packaging after a deodorant spray? Only one container is appropriate
The classic spray deodorant consists of a metal packaging, a plastic tip and a nut and a coupled liquid. So these are three different materials. Before you throw away the packaging, make sure it’s empty. According to information on the website of the Warsaw City Hall, Aerosols must be thrown into a container for metals and plastics. It has a yellow color. In a situation where the can is not empty, it should be taken to PSZOK, i.e. the Selective Municipal Waste Collection Point.
